Regional Cancer Center is Hiring a Nurse Navigator Near Rockford, IL

Nursing
Regional Cancer Center
MSO REGIONAL CANCER CENTER
Full Time · Day Shift · Monday - Friday 0700 - 1800

Provides holistic, age and culturally appropriate comprehensive nursing care in collaboration with a physician across the continuum of care. Functions as a consultant, role model, researcher and educator, ensuring quality patient care and outcomes. Coordinates optimal resources within the multi-disciplinary team of physicians, nurses, managers clinical specialists, patients and families. Participates in continuous quality improvement activities and educational experiences in support of the oncology service line and divisional nursing philosophy and objectives, as well as Health System initiatives.

EDUCATION/TRAINING:

BSN or related field preferred, with experience in patient education, planning, management and coordination of care for patients and families in health and/or oncology clinical coordination. Must complete designated educational courses/activities required by the department (course/activities may vary by department); oncology experience and case management preferred.

LICENSURE/CERTIFICATION:

OCN Certification and/or willing to pursue. Current Nurse licensure in the State of Illinois. Annual BLS required. ACLS certification, if applicable (varies by department). Certification as a Nurse Navigator within one year of hire, if applicable (varies by department).

EXPERIENCE/SKILLS/ABILITIES:

Successful completion of annual clinical, age and job specific competencies and skill validation tools. Good interpersonal skills and ability to relate well with levels within the organization and community. Excellent verbal, written, organizational and critical decision-making skills required.
